[Photograph 2012.201.B1032.0334]

Photograph used for a story in the Daily Oklahoman newspaper. Caption: "Until comparatively recent years the Arbuckles were a primitive spot. Abundant water attracted settlers long before Oklahoma was a state. Old water wheels and abandoned grist mills are still to be found here and there. This wheel is near Price's Falls."
Date: July 17, 1946
Creator: Meek, Richard B.
